2024年美国大学生数学建模竞赛
E题 财产保险的可持续性
原题再现:
极端天气事件正在成为财产所有者和保险公司的危机。近年来,全世界"遭受了 1000 多起极端天气事件造成的超过1万亿美元的损失"。“保险业 2022年的自然灾害理赔额比 30 年的平均水平增加了"115%”。叫由于洪水、飓风、气旋、干旱和野火等恶劣天气相关事件造成的损失可能会增加,预计情况会变得更糟。保险费正在迅速上涨,预计到 2040年,气候变化将使保险费上涨 30%-60%。
财产保险不仅越来越贵,而且越来越难找,因为保险公司改变了他们愿意承保的方式和地点。与天气有关的事故导致财产保险费的上涨,这取决于您所处的地理位置。此外,全世界的保险保障缺口平均为 57%,而且还在不断扩大。"]这凸显了该行业的两难处境–保险公司的盈利能力和财产所有人的经济承受能力正在出现危机。
中国大洋协会的巨灾保险建模人员(ICM)对财产保险业的可持续性很感兴趣。由于气候变化增加了发生更多恶劣天气和自然灾害的可能性,ICM 希望确定现在如何对财产保险做出最好的定位,从而使该系统具有抵御未来索赔成本的能力,同时确保保险公司的长期健康发展。如果保险公司在太多情况下不愿承保,它们就会因客户太少而倒闭。反之,如果保险公司承保的保单风险过高,则可能会支付过多的赔款。保險公司應在甚麼情况下承保?什么时候应该选择承担风险?业主是否可以做些什么来影响这一决定?为保险公司建立一个模型,以确定他们是否应该在极端天气事件不断增加的地区承保。使用位于不同大洲的两个发生极端天气事件的地区来演示您的模型。
展望未来,社区和房地产开发商需要扪心自问,如何以及在何处进行建设和发展。随着保险环境的变化,未来的房地产决策必须确保房地产具有更强的抗灾能力,并经过深思熟虑,包括为不断增长的社区和人口提供适当服务的可行性。如何调整您的保险模式,以评估在何处、如何以及是否在某些地点进行建设?
在某些社区,您的保险模式可能建议不承保当前或未来的财产保险。这可能会导致社区领导者对具有文化或社区意义的财产做出艰难的决定。例如,北卡罗来纳州外滩的哈特拉斯角灯塔被迁移,以保护这座历史悠久的灯塔以及以其为中心的当地旅游业。B作为社区领导者,您如何识别社区中的建筑?
由于其文化、历史、经济或社区意义而应得到保存和保护的建筑?开发一个保护模式,供社区领导人使用,以确定他们应在多大程度上采取措施保护社区内的建筑物。选择一个历史地标(不是哈特拉斯角灯塔),该地标所在位置会遭遇极端天气事件。运用您的保险和保护模式来评估这个地标的价值。根据您从保险和保护模型结果中获得的洞察力,撰写一封一页纸的信,向社区建议一个计划、时间表和成本提案,以保护他们珍爱的地标。
整体求解过程概述(摘要)
在全球气候变化的背景下,极端天气事件日益频繁,给财产保险业带来重大挑战。这项研究提出了一个全面的分析框架,解决财产保险部门在极端天气条件下的可持续性。首先,我们采用多尺度地理加权回归(MGWR)模型,综合气候数据、地理位置和保险理赔数据,分析极端天气对保险赔付的影响。模型结果表明,考虑空间异质性可以更准确地预测保险理赔金额,为保险公司提供科学的风险评估工具。例如,我们观察到在某些高风险地区,保险赔付与极端环境事件发生概率之间存在显著正相关。
针对第一个问题,我们提出了一种基于风险的保险定价策略,该策略平衡了保险公司的长期健康状况和业主的财务负担。通过引入人道主义调整系数和盈利能力调整系数,我们的模型为不同风险水平的保险产品定价,实现了社会责任和经济效率之间的平衡。例如,我们的模型预测2023年加州(一个高风险地区)的保险金额为209.94万美元,到2034年预计将增加到3100.54万美元。
关于第二个问题,我们制定了社区建设和发展战略,以适应气候变化带来的风险。通过数据标准化、熵计算和加权,我们为业主提供了影响保险公司决策的策略,从而降低了保险成本。例如,我们建议社区可以通过提高人均GDP、控制人口密度、提高医疗质量和支持教育发展来降低保险成本。
在处理第三个问题时,我们侧重于保护历史地标,特别是自由女神像。利用MGWR模型,结合建筑物保护优先事项,我们评估了自由女神像的保护需求。我们的详细保护计划为社区提供了缓解极端天气对这一文化符号的潜在影响的措施。例如,拟议的保护措施包括结构加固、环境监测系统安装和应急响应规划,估计每年投资约250万美元。
总之,本研究为保险公司在极端天气条件下承保提供决策支持,并为社区和遗产保护提供切实可行的策略。我们的框架强调科学分析、社区参与和多目标优化的重要性,提出了应对气候变化挑战的综合方法。
模型假设:
为了简化我们的模型并消除复杂性,我们在本文献中做出以下主要假设。所有假设在构建模型时使用后将再次强调:
1、数据完整性和质量:官方数据集包含研究所需的所有必要信息,无需补充数据。该数据集全面覆盖了所需变量,质量高,保证了分析的可靠性。
2、极端天气事件的空间异质性:极端天气事件对不同地理位置保险赔付的影响存在显著的空间异质性。多尺度地理加权回归(MGWR)模型可以有效地捕捉这种异质性,从而实现更准确的保险定价和风险评估。
3、社会经济因素与保险需求的相关性:人均GDP、人口密度、受教育程度等社会经济因素与保险需求、风险评估存在显著相关性。这支持了使用熵权法确定人道主义调整系数(HAC)的有效性,突出了这些因素在制定保险策略中的重要性。
问题重述:
问题1:气候变化下的保险承保策略:开发一个模型,帮助保险公司决定是否在受极端天气事件影响日益严重的地区承保,这是一个复杂的挑战。这种模式必须平衡保险公司的长期健康和财产所有者的财务负担。
问题2:面临气候风险的社区建设和发展:适应不断变化的保险环境需要采用细致入微的方法来评估在特定地点建设和发展的风险。面对这些风险,确保财产弹性和可持续社区发展至关重要。
问题3:在气候威胁下保护历史地标:选择历史地标并应用保险和保护模型评估其价值是一个独特的挑战。对于社区而言,这涉及到提出一个全面的保护计划,其中包括建议的措施、时间表和相关费用,以保护这些文化宝藏免受极端天气的破坏。
模型的建立与求解整体论文缩略图
全部论文请见下方“ 只会建模 QQ名片” 点击QQ名片即可
代码:(文档not free)
import pandas as pd from sklearn.model_selection import train_test_split from sklearn.ensemble import RandomForestClassifier from sklearn.metrics import accuracy_score # 加载数据集 data = pd.read_csv("insurance_data.csv") # 划分特征和标签 X = data.drop("should_underwrite_policy", axis=1) y = data["should_underwrite_policy"] # 划分训练集和测试集 X_train, X_test, y_train, y_test = train_test_split(X, y, test_size=0.2, random_state=42) # 训练随机森林分类器模型 clf = RandomForestClassifier() clf.fit(X_train, y_train) # 在测试集上进行预测 y_pred = clf.predict(X_test) # 计算模型准确率 accuracy = accuracy_score(y_test, y_pred) print("模型准确率:", accuracy)
from sklearn.tree import DecisionTreeClassifier import pandas as pd # 加载数据集 data = pd.read_csv("property_development_data.csv") # 划分特征和标签 X = data.drop("construction_decision", axis=1) y = data["construction_decision"] # 建立决策树分类模型 model = DecisionTreeClassifier() model.fit(X, y) # 输入新的地点信息,预测建设决策 new_location = [[geo_feature1, geo_feature2, climate_feature1, climate_feature2, historical_disaster_data]] decision = model.predict(new_location) print("建设决策:", decision)
# 建立多因素评分模型 def protection_model(building): score = 0 # 根据建筑的文化价值、历史意义、经济贡献、社区认同等方面进行评估 if building.cultural_value == "high": score += 3 elif building.cultural_value == "medium": score += 2 else: score += 1 if building.historical_significance == "high": score += 3 elif building.historical_significance == "medium": score += 2 else: score += 1 if building.economic_contribution == "high": score += 3 elif building.economic_contribution == "medium": score += 2 else: score += 1 if building.community_identity == "high": score += 3 elif building.community_identity == "medium": score += 2 else: score += 1 return score # 示例建筑类 class Building: def __init__(self, cultural_value, historical_significance, economic_contribution, community_identity): self.cultural_value = cultural_value self.historical_significance = historical_significance self.economic_contribution = economic_contribution self.community_identity = community_identity # 示例建筑 building = Building(cultural_value="high", historical_significance="high", economic_contribution="medium", community_identity="high") # 使用保护模型评估建筑重要性 importance_score = protection_model(building) print("建筑重要性评分:", importance_score)
还没有评论,来说两句吧...